About Zrist DX
Experience the unpredictable thrill of Zrist DX, where speedy reflexes are essential. Navigate a shifting landscape, dodge dynamic obstacles, and stay stylish by earning credits for trendy outfits. With rapidly changing rules and endless gameplay, every session offers a fresh, exhilarating challenge. Adapt quickly and embrace the chaos!
